Output e8c1339b26c35a8e5ca4ffba3b0e39c8192d0fd2276109b5a514d140582ee1d6:3

value
29442691
script pubkey
OP_0 OP_PUSHBYTES_20 35920544de2369d7403b7f5ba321765d6575d481
address
ltc1qxkfq23x7yd5awspm0ad6xgtkt4jht4yptfkd2r
transaction
e8c1339b26c35a8e5ca4ffba3b0e39c8192d0fd2276109b5a514d140582ee1d6
spent
true